Transaction ec9161a8e8893463e67a87f6c6ffdfdc9beb85814fecdfd8de525c0c9f42c8d8
1 Input
1 Output
-
ec9161a8e8893463e67a87f6c6ffdfdc9beb85814fecdfd8de525c0c9f42c8d8:0
- value
- 309885450
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 38ac6c1c4ec61370da610d061d76066e5fbe9ca1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16AfPrZFfqAPzKYt4SaYCKBq9CYLsLxaoW